CVE-2018-7099

5.5 · MEDIUM
Published Aug 14, 2018 hp EPSS 0.40% (33th pctl)

Overview

CVE-2018-7099 is a medium-severity vulnerability affecting hp 3par_service_provider. It was published on August 14, 2018 and has a CVSS 3.0 base score of 5.5 (MEDIUM).

This vulnerability has a CVSS 3.0 base score of 5.5, rated MEDIUM. It requires local or adjacent network access to exploit. Some level of privileges is required for exploitation.

Technical Description

A security vulnerability was identified in 3PAR Service Processor (SP) prior to SP-4.4.0.GA-110(MU7). The vulnerability may be locally exploited to allow disclosure of privileged information.
